Enter super useful application Slide Actions which, er, allows you to perform actions on sliding your Touch Dual closed!
From the application page....
Quote
Configuration options:
- Hang Up: If checked any calls will be hung up when the slide closes.
- No Locking: If checked, closing the slide does not lock the keys.
- Lock Keys: If checked, closing the slide locks the device.
- Invoke S2U2: If checked, instead of locking the keys S2U2 is invoked (inversely it will hide S2U2 on slide open).
- Apply and start saves the selected configuration and starts/restarts SlideActions.
